Application Process
- Contact Camp Crook Town Hall to discuss your project (referral through Harding County offices may be necessary).
- Complete required permit application forms.
- Submit application with required documentation and site plans.
- Town staff review for code compliance.
- Pay applicable permit fees.
- Obtain permit and schedule required inspections.
- Conduct construction under permit.
- Request final inspection and Certificate of Occupancy.

General Requirements
A construction permit is required for new structures and additions within the Town of Camp Crook.
Required Documents
- Completed application form
- Site plan showing property lines and proposed structure location
- Property description
- Construction plans and drawings (as required for project type)
- Permit validity
- Not publicly stated; contact Town Hall
- Building code
- Camp Crook, as a South Dakota municipality, must comply with the 2021 International Building Code as its minimum standard as required by South Dakota Codified Laws Chapter 11-10. Specific details about which code edition is currently enforced and any local amendments are not documented online. Contact Town Hall for confirmation.
- Owner-builder
- Not publicly stated; contact Town Hall
- Contractor requirements
- State registration under SDCL Chapter 36-21C (administered by South Dakota Department of Labor and Regulation) is required for residential contractors. Electrical and plumbing work requires a state-licensed contractor regardless of project size.
